Skip to content

Commit cf2894c

Browse files
4vtomatakuhlens
authored andcommitted
[RISCV] Use StringRef for RequiredExtensions in RVVIntrinsicDef (llvm#143503)
This prevents many duplicated copies of required extensions string.
1 parent 086e284 commit cf2894c

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

clang/lib/Sema/SemaRISCV.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-47,7 +47,7 @@ struct RVVIntrinsicDef {
4747
std::string BuiltinName;
4848

4949
/// Mapping to RequiredFeatures in riscv_vector.td
50-
std::string RequiredExtensions;
50+
StringRef RequiredExtensions;
5151

5252
/// Function signature, first element is return type.
5353
RVVTypes Signature;

0 commit comments

Comments
 (0)